ADVANCING DOD CAPABILITY-BASED PLANNING AND MANAGEMENT
The Strategic Planning Guidance emphasizes continuing to build on Department of Defense capability-based planning and management efforts. Joint capability portfolio management (CPM) has become the means for following this guidance. CPM restructures development and resourcing of current and new capabilities, and their alignment to meet future warfighter needs. To test CPM viability, the Deputy Secretary of Defense, through his advisory working group, selected four capability areas—one of which was Joint Logistics (JtLog)—as test cases.
Throughout the JtLog test case—from development of the master test case plan to more specialized test case support—we worked side by side with senior DoD logistics leaders, helping them chart the future for logistics portfolio analysis and management. LMI helped develop the first DoD-wide supply chain operations (SCO) process map and assisted SCO test case process analysis teams in their investigation of the interfaces between the supply, maintenance, and distribution processes. We also proposed new logistics governance constructs to aid in execution of JtLog CPM.
The work of the JtLog test case participants culminated in validation of CPM principles and recommendations critical in implementing JtLog portfolio management. LMI was a major contributor to those results.
